Last weekend the IRB Racing team migrated south to the border to compete at Coolangatta Beach in the second and third rounds of the 5 race series,
Ocean Roar. The team arrived early on the beach Saturday morning to be greeted with perfect racing conditions. Two of our young team members were
racing their very first carnival and like the previous week when Faith took to the sport like a “Duck to water” with results to show, both Santosha
and Jessica were completely in their element showing the preseason training had well and truly prepared them for racing with both featuring in
the finals. Despite not all teams making it to the finals, all teams were strong competitors in every heat and semi they competed in with Coolum
only just missing out having 3 teams in the Masters Mass Final. Results from Saturday saw Shane & Frank with Faith and Jess finish 3rd in Masters
Mass with Alastair & Jason with Santosha & Kirra in 7th. Masters Teams Rescue saw Fred/Mark, Shane/Frank with Kirra and Faith bring home
another third place. Shane/Frank with Faith brought home the weekend’s best finals result with a second in Masters Surf Rescue.
Sunday saw the start of round 3 with a completely different set of conditions to contend with. Sadly a few of our competitors were unable to compete
for the full day on Sunday, so the team rallied very well under the leadership of James and still put up a great competitive effort with every
team making it to a final.
Perhaps the standout performance for the weekend was our Open Teams Rescue team of Alastair/Jason with Caleb/Dan and patients Santosha and Mark
(“Ill Do it”) who made it to the Grand Final and finished a creditable 7th in a field of arguably some the best IRB Racers in Australia. Fred/Mark
with Santosha came in 3rd in their Surf Rescue while Shane/Frank and Caleb brought home 4th place. Unfortunately, due to trip on the final
sprint up the beach, the Masters Teams Rescue missed taking second in their final on Sunday afternoon.
